Output 4dafc99fd4ceb50c8fad30fe80da8b681cac9a87d32419dab15c50b74af4ecaa:25

value
68276900
script pubkey
OP_0 OP_PUSHBYTES_20 0681c5cbb12fffb3b0c28fedb1fc8512c927357d
address
bc1qq6qutja39llm8vxz3lkmrly9ztyjwdtaey4nq8
transaction
4dafc99fd4ceb50c8fad30fe80da8b681cac9a87d32419dab15c50b74af4ecaa
spent
true